New York State School of Clay- Work- ing and Ceramics

In the field of applied science and commerci'll engineer- ing the subject of Ulay·Working is l:eco\lling daily more important. To the architect, and bullder clay offm:s the most satisfactory fire-proof muterial. to thc housewife pottery is inclispensable I1nd to tho artist cl"y and clay- wares a:ITord at once a facHe means of exp1'0ssion and a.

promiue'(lt ien"tufu of hom!:) decoration.

The problems which confront tho day-workol' are uniquo. He must learn to win his material economically from tho oorth, to shapo his ware.s with duo rogl1rd to hoth utility und art, to gbze or oUml'wise finish thorn in a s'ltisfactory manner and to bum 1;ho whoh, successfolly upon a largo scale. His celuClltioll must therefore be com- prehensive and complete. He must, ill " word, be t\

specialist and to this end the New York State Sehoal was eshtblishotL

Ohaptol' 383, Laws of Now York Stato, 1900, providml for tho constl'uction atHi maintenanco of the selwol and ill ordm' to securo the necessary -racDitios for eollu,teru-t bmllches qf study Alfred University was cbosen as the, locution,

'For this work the UllivGl'sity offors great adb vantages. I...abora1.,orios of chemistry and ph,Ysicst ,

librari()s, xnuseums. of geology and natural bistory~ work- shops fot' manu,,] tl'llining and all the departments {)f liberal cultul'fl aro available! so that tho many ttnd varied reqniremlmts of f1 libcro.l educaj,ioll "1'0 fully met.

'!'he S(<tte of New York cont(l.in8 vastdeposiCs of clays

!tnd shales at pres~nt lying dormant, it also cont!Lius large

numbers of young men and women who are seeking profit- able emp1oyment. 'rho, work

or

the scboo1 is to. bring these together. Neither the science nor the art is )1eglect~

ed. Attention is given to the improvements of metho.ds

Df mtmufacture 3ind tho reduction Df cost so. that the 1'0"

SDurces o.f the state ma.y be fully developed and that ,vith~

in its borders ma,y be lllanuft~ctured the cla,y-wt):ros, both·

coarse and fine! necessary fD): its own consnmption.

Building and Equipment

The building of the Ne\v York State SchDol Df Clay- WOl'lting and CeraInics has been especially designed and is IDcated on land purclmsed for the PUl'pose and deed~d

to the people of the State ()f New York, It is built of red bdclr and terra·cQtta with grny trimmings a.nd 1'o.o.fed with brown tile: It has R< fioQr space of abDut thirteen thoQ.~

sand square feet. and a frontage of seventy-five feet.

In the lower story al'e located the heavy lnacbinei·y tor the manuf~tcture of brick. tile, "hollow blocks and roof- ing tile, the slip-making plant, (~y1indel's for glaze prepar- ation} and ~ wDrlrshop fitted with modern ::tppli~nce$ for' pottery and porcelain manufacture. There are also rooms fot' mold making and dryhlg. and a, damp cella!>/ /

'1"11(3 motive power is supplied by a 30 h:'p. Otto ga.$

engine. and a 2 h. p. Rumsey gas engine; natural gas be~

ing available,

Ou the pdncipal floor are located, th~ execntive offices, rooms fDr the Director, laboratories, and a class rooin, Here the experimental work is dDne.

'rho Technical laboratDries are pl'ovided with'sman blungers and mills fD:r working clay samplos, small gas furnaces for fritting ~tnd fusing, and apparatus for the testing of clay.

second floor. Studios are arranged, provided with the facilities necessary fol" the practice of mechanical draw- ing, fl,~ee~hand drawing and applied ,design. Adjoining these is the modeling room where, in addition to orna·

mental work in clay, the production of pure form is studied. Space is -provided for a ceramic museum in which eX~1rop]es of clay wol'lr qf every type may be found.

Adjacept to the m~in building is the Kiln House, with~

in which are two kilns; one for firing common wares at a low temperatufOt the other fOl," fidng fine wares Utt a high temperature,

In addition to tbis oquipment it is worthy of note that within a short distance of the school the:t,'e are two plants in whiQh are manufactured b)'iclts by both the wet an4 dry processes, several styles of roofing tHe, and quarries tor floors and roofs. Here may be seen the act- ual working of m~nufacturil1g plants, and the use of at least th)'ee Idnds of kilns) including a continuolls kUn.

Tuition

Students who are residents of New York State are exempt fI'om payment of tuition by the provision$ of the act establishing the school.

To studentsfrotn other states, an annual tuition fee of $.50 will be charged.

Small -incidental fees to covel"' cost of materials and breakage are req uireq.

Courses Offered

The courses of stu(ly which lead to the degree of B, S. extend over a period of foul' yeaTS and embrace, to- gether wit.h the science, technology and urt spedal to obI.\"

working, snch subjects as arc the equivalont of the usual conego COUl'SQ, Cert"in subjects are l'cquirml, but tho technical work is elect.ive as to the ImrMeular branch of ceramics to be J'ollowed.

rrhe eoursc in ccra-miu art is intended to fit tho student for tIm designing ami producing of artistic pottery.

'rhe course covers a wide field of art and letters in the belief that a successful artist must possess a liberal education.

For the accommodation of those desiring 1.0 qualify as teachers it is permitted to elect Psychology, History of Education and Pedagogy in place of: othol' college subjects~

An opportunity for practice teachiug is afforded in tho pu bIle schools of AUt'cd,

Studonts having It pl'actiml1 knowledge of clay,work·

ing will be rooeived fol' short terms, and oortiticatos will be given according to the work dOllO.

The State School of Ceramics is fitted and the ex- perts in charge are qualified for the professional exami- nation and testing of cIa,ys for economic purposes. Such clays may be chtssified ~nder the fol1owhlg heads:

(a) Kaolin, white burning residual clay.

(b) Kaolin, white bllrni(lg, washed fol' mark,ot, used in the manufacture of pottery, porcelain and

paper.

(c) Ball cla.y, whltJC or cream burmng. scdimental'Y clay of high plasticity. used in pottery m~tnufacture.

(d) Stone ware clay, gray or cream burning, more or less sandy in character, used in stoneware manufacture.

(e) Fire clay, buff or white burning, refractory, used for manufacture of 11:ro brick.

(1) Brick clay, including colored clays and shales, used for the manufacture of brick and tile of various qualities and descriptions.
